CATHERINE CALLAWAY, CNN ANCHOR: And the resort town of Laughlin, Nevada is on edge tonight following a deadly shootout between rival motorcycle gangs at a popular casino there. And CNN'S Thelma Gutierrez is in Laughlin. She's joining us now to tell us exactly what happened.

Thelma?

THELMA GUTIERREZ, CNN CORRESPONDENT: Catherine, Harrah's Casino is still closed out here in Laughlin. Many of the guests at the hotel just packed it up and they've gone to other hotels. Police say that they have arrested a large number of people in connection to this morning's shootings, but they would not exactly say how many were arrested. They did say, however, that they talked to more than 200 people in connection with those shootings.

I want Gay to pan over now onto to Casino Drive, right outside of Harrah's, the main street here. For the most part, the 20th annual river run for motorcycle enthusiasts is going strong. None of the events have been canceled for the tens of thousands of cyclists out here, despite one of the most violent nights in the town's history.

GUTIERREZ (voice-over): It's being called the worst shooting ever inside a Nevada casino.

VINCE CANNITO, LT., LAS VEGAS POLICE DEPT.: Shots are being fired inside the hotel. People are being stabbed.

UNIDENTIFIED MALE: I ran for safety, just like everybody else.

GUTIERREZ: Laughlin, Nevada, Harrah's Hotel and Casino on the river. 2:15 Saturday morning. A fist fight breaks out between two rival gang members, the Mongols and Hell's Angels.

UNIDENTIFIED MALE: One of the Mongols walked into a group of Hell's Angels.

GUTIERREZ: Moments later, rival gang members draw their weapons and begin firing at each other. A gun battle erupts right on the casino floor, as terrified guests scramble for cover.

UNIDENTIFIED MALE: There were bodies around, lots of bodies. UNIDENTIFIED FEMALE: It was really upsetting because we could actually see a dead body from our room on the street. I mean, they had a sheet over it, but it was obvious what it was. And just feel really sad about it, because it's lot of great people here, trying to have a good time.

GUTIERREZ: Three men die on the spot. Four others are airlifted to the hospital in Las Vegas. 13 people are wounded, either stabbed or shot.

CANNITO: The first suspect was taken into custody roughly less than two minutes after this incident took place.

GUTIERREZ: This videotape was shot by a guest of the hotel in the aftermath of the gun fight, as suspects are rounded up. You see what appears to be an officer struggling with the suspect. His weapons goes off. Police say it was accidentally discharged. Dozens of people are ordered to lie face down on the ground. Police detain more than 200 people for questioning and try to separate the victims from the suspects.

UNIDENTIFIED MALE: It was utter chaos. People were terrified.

GUTIERREZ: After the shooting, Harrah's Hotel and Casino, one of the largest in Laughlin, is completely locked down. Guests are questioned. Some are free to leave, others like this man, who was not in the hotel at the time, is not allowed back inside.

UNIDENTIFIED MALE: My cell phone's in my room. I have no access to my vehicle or my room.

UNIDENTIFIED FEMALE: They're telling us that they don't know when we're going to be able to get back into the hotel. So we're just kind of all hoofing it and hoping for the best.

GUTIERREZ: Police say their concern now is not only trying to figure out what caused the gun fight, and who's involved, but also keeping the peace when so many may be tempted to retaliate.

(END VIDEOTAPE)

In addition to the three men who were killed here at Harrah's, we should mention that the bullet-riddled body of a 29-year old man was a biker, was found off the Quarty (ph) Freeway, which is between here, Laughlin, and Los Angeles in San Bernadino COunty. Police have not said whether or not that murder is connected to the shootings that happened here in Laughlin.

CALLAWAY: Thelma, there has to be concern, as you said, about possible retaliation from these two rival groups. What's being done there tonight to sort of calm fears there?

GUTIERREZ: Well, police say that they have all their forces in from Las Vegas to make sure they're able to keep the peace. But they say they haven't had any word, they haven't had any overt threat, anything like that. They're just hoping that people will remain calm and that there will be no retaliation and no further violence. But they say they are prepared.
